Как будут располагаться элементы массива BIM 24 11 35 7 18 в таблице после каждой перестановки элементов массива
Как будут располагаться элементы массива BIM 24 11 35 7 18 в таблице после каждой перестановки элементов массива при его сортировке по убыванию?
26.03.2024 22:08
Разъяснение: Для сортировки массива по убыванию, используется алгоритм сортировки пузырьком. Этот алгоритм проходит по массиву несколько раз, меняя местами соседние элементы, пока весь массив не будет отсортирован по убыванию.
В данной задаче, нам дан массив BIM [24, 11, 35, 7, 18]. Начнем сортировку с помощью алгоритма сортировки пузырьком:
1) Проходим по массиву и сравниваем каждую пару соседних элементов. Если элемент слева больше элемента справа, меняем их местами.
[24, 11, 35, 7, 18] -> [24, 35, 11, 7, 18] -> [24, 35, 11, 7, 18] -> [24, 35, 11, 7, 18] -> [24, 35, 18, 7, 11]
2) Повторяем процесс для всех элементов, кроме последнего, и исключаем уже отсортированные элементы.
[35, 24, 18, 7, 11]
3) Повторяем шаг 1 и 2 до тех пор, пока массив полностью отсортирован.
[35, 24, 18, 11, 7] - массив отсортирован по убыванию.
Совет: Чтобы лучше понять алгоритм сортировки пузырьком, можно использовать иллюстрации или визуализацию шагов алгоритма. Также полезно понимать, что основная идея сортировки пузырьком заключается в том, что большие элементы "всплывают" вверх массива по мере прохода по нему.
Задание для закрепления: Как будет выглядеть массив после каждого прохода алгоритма сортировки пузырьком для массива [5, 2, 8, 1, 6]?